One of the most popular types of reverse home loans is the Home Equity Conversion Home Mortgage (HECM), which is backed by Find more info the federal government. Regardless of the reverse home loan idea in practice, qualified house owners might not be able to borrow the whole worth of their home even if the mortgage is paid off.

Homeowners are likely to get a higher principal limit the older they are, the more the property deserves and the lower the interest rate. The amount might increase if the customer has a variable-rate HECM. With a variable rate, alternatives consist of: Equal month-to-month payments, supplied a minimum of one borrower lives in the home as their primary house Equal regular monthly payments for a fixed duration of months settled on ahead of time A credit line that can be accessed till it goes out A mix of a line of credit and fixed monthly payments for as long as you live in the house A combination of a line of credit plus fixed month-to-month payments for a set length of time If you pick a HECM with a fixed interest rate, on the other hand, you'll get a single-disbursement, lump-sum payment.

Based upon the results, the lending institution could need funds to be reserved from the loan proceeds to pay things like real estate tax, house owner's insurance, and flood insurance (if suitable). If this is not needed, you still could concur that your loan provider will pay these products. If you have a "set-aside" or you concur to have the lender make these payments, those amounts will be subtracted from the amount you get in loan profits.

You may be able to borrow more money with a proprietary reverse home loan. But the more you obtain, the higher the costs you'll pay. You also may consider a HECM loan. A HECM counselor or a lending institution can help you compare these types of loans side by side, to see what you'll get and what it costs.

While the home loan insurance coverage premium is normally the same from loan provider to lending institution, the majority of loan expenses including origination charges, rates of interest, closing expenses, and maintenance fees differ amongst lenders. Ask a therapist or lender to discuss the Overall Yearly Loan Cost (TALC) rates: they reveal the forecasted yearly average cost of a reverse home mortgage, consisting of all the itemized costs.

You don't need to buy any financial items, services or financial investment to get a reverse mortgage. In fact, in some situations, it's prohibited to require you to buy other items to get a reverse home mortgage.

Stop and consult a counselor or someone you trust before you sign anything. A reverse mortgage can be complicated, and isn't something to rush into. The bottom line: If you do not comprehend the expense or functions of a reverse home mortgage, walk away. If you feel pressure or urgency to finish the deal walk away.

With the majority of reverse mortgages, you have at least three business days after closing to cancel the offer for any factor, without penalty. This is understood as your right of "rescission." To cancel, you must notify the lending institution in writing. Send your letter by certified mail, and request a return receipt.

Keep copies of your correspondence and any enclosures. After you cancel, the lender has 20 days to return any money you've paid for the financing. If you think a rip-off, or that someone involved in the deal might be breaking the law, let the therapist, lender, or loan servicer understand.
